Abstract
Melamine is made by heating urea and/or one or more pyrolysis products thereof in the presence of ammonia and a catalyst comprising BPO4 and/or AlPO4 adsorbed on a carrier, e.g. SiO2, Al2O3 or C. Examples describe the preparation of melamine using two reactors, the first of which has a fluidized bed of catalyst material and the other a fixed bed of catalyst material, passage of urea amounting to 100 gms./hour. Suitable reaction temperatures are above 220 DEG C., e.g. 350 DEG C. Specifications 767,344, 910,197, 910,198, 915,234, 926,594 and 969,298 are referred to.
